Cucumber Dill Greek Yogurt Rotisserie Chicken Salad

- 3 cups rotisserie chicken, chopped and chilled
- 2/3 cup full-fat Greek yogurt
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- Juice of 1/2 lemon
- 1/3 cup green onion, chopped
- 3/4 cup seedless cucumber, peeled and chopped
- 1/2 cup celery, chopped
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1 teaspoon dried dill
- 1 teaspoon sea salt
- 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
Step-by-Step Instructions
- In a large bowl, combine the chopped rotisserie chicken, Greek yogurt,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, chopped green onion, chopped cucumber, chopped celery, chopped parsley, dried dill, sea salt, and black pepper.
- Stir all the ingredients together until they are completely combined and the chicken is evenly coated.
- Taste and adjust seasonings if necessary.
- For best results and to maintain the crispness of the cucumber, it is recommended to add the cucumber right before serving if making this salad ahead of time.

For the best flavor and texture, use good quality rotisserie chicken. The depth of flavor from a pre-cooked rotisserie chicken is superior to canned chicken or plain grilled chicken. When choosing your Greek yogurt, full-fat will give you the creamiest texture, but you can opt for lower-fat versions if preferred. If you are making this salad ahead of time, consider adding the cucumber just before serving to prevent it from becoming watery and losing its satisfying crunch.Variations & Substitutions
Feel free to customize this salad to your liking. If you’re not a fan of dill, try fresh chives or tarragon. For a bit of spice, add a pinch of red pepper flakes. If you prefer a tangier flavor, increase the amount of lemon juice. For a different texture, you can add chopped bell peppers or a sprinkle of toasted almonds. If you don’t have fresh parsley, dried parsley can be used, though fresh will provide a brighter flavor.Serving Suggestions

Store any leftover Cucumber Dill Greek Yogurt Rotisserie Chicken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Due to the fresh cucumber and Greek yogurt, this salad is not recommended for freezing, as the texture can become compromised upon thawing. Can I use pre-cooked chicken breast instead of rotisserie chicken?
Yes, you can use pre-cooked chicken breast. Ensure it is seasoned well, as rotisserie chicken often has more flavor.
How can I make this chicken salad less watery?
To prevent the salad from becoming watery, especially if making it ahead of time, wait to add the chopped cucumber until just before serving. Also, ensure your Greek yogurt is well-drained if it has excess liquid.
Can I substitute mayonnaise for Greek yogurt?
You can substitute mayonnaise for Greek yogurt, but it will change the nutritional profile and the overall lightness of the salad. If you choose to do so, you might prefer a combination of both for creaminess and flavor.
How long does this chicken salad last in the refrigerator?
This chicken salad will last for about 3-4 days when st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
